Actually, rereading this it's become apparent that it cannot be reliably done. The problem is that the cms plugin may ask the redirector to actually deliver the data. In that case, localroot needs to be valid. Since the system cannot determine if that will ever happen, if a localroot was specified it needs to be valid just in case. Now, if that is not the case (i.e. the plugin will never deliver data via he redirector) then simply move the "oss.localroot" directive to the stanza that contains "all.role server" and the problem will be solved.
